Low-cost WiFi and LoRa gateway add-on offers flexible configuration options
April 13th - via: linuxgizmos.com
A Barcelona-based startup called Qortex is close to reaching its $1,189 Kickstarter goal for a flexible, ESP8266-based “Axon” WiFi and/or LoRa gateway. The device can double as a sensor add-on to a Raspberry Pi, Arduino, or any other board that supports serial communications. (Read More)
